Terry & Gary Foster went to another cave, again an old good roost but this one had filled with water. Again a zero nite.
1 August
Sam and I went to a "guaranteed roost" of several thousand M. austroriparius.
This a cave in Suwanee Co. where histoplasmosis was confirmed after a church group using the field got sick.

Roosts.
the sinkholes had been filled with trash.
No bats.
During the day Sam & I had gone to Devils den - a sinkhole in Williston. Heard squeaking and collected a Bufo within the cave.
